In the debate on the evolution and development of competitive  advantage, the most famous work has been that of Michael E. Porter. In   The Competitive Advantage of Nations, Porter argues that national competitiveness finds its origins in geographic isolation which was the impetus for the kind and degree of innovation that characterized the  nature and scope of  economic and industrial activity within successful sectors in developed economies.  Competitive advantage in developed nations, as argued by Porter, owes  itself to a cultural pre-disposition, an acumen as it were, that became  culturally imbedded in those societies over an extended period of time.  This work seeks to identify what are the cultural facets that define  competitive advantage within small developing states. In doing so, it  identifies the link between culture and economic activity as is  manifested in Trinidad and Tobago and defines the nature and scope of  the Diamond and Cluster of those industrial sectors that are studied.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"aw-variant-hidden-subtitle-div\" id=\"aw-variant-subtitle-9783843354189\"\u003e\u003ch3\u003eThe case of a small developing country as Trinidad and Tobago\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"Autorenwelt Shop","offers":[{"title":"Softcover - 9783843354189","offer_id":39470109458525,"sku":"9783843354189","price":79.0,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0940\/0622\/files\/6ec279f8-966f-4f30-ae40-b31fe00bd70d.jpg?v=1772866080","url":"https:\/\/shop.autorenwelt.de\/en\/products\/international-competitiveness-von-barry-ishmael","provider":"Autorenwelt Shop","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
